I received my DDS from the University of California, at San Francisco in 1988, then joined the Army where I served for 6 years as a dental officer. I served mostly in Mannheim Germany but gained valuable experience providing emergency and surgical care for soldiers and their families while they trained and readied for deployment.

Upon returning to California, I served at Fort Ord. After leaving the service I became a partner in a dental group in Santa Cruz, until I decided to open my own office in 1999. I have lived in Scotts Valley for 22 years and I love it here. My wife is a Registered Nurse, Both of my kids attended our local public schools.

I am a adjunct clinical instructor for the Cabrillo College Dental Hygiene Program. I also have been a volunteer instructor for the dental assisting training program though the Santa Cruz County Regional Occupational Program since 1994. I have participated in providing dentistry to local Veterans and  dental health screenings at local schools by members of the Monterey bay Dental Society. I am a member of the  Kiwanis of the (SV/SLV) Valleys .

I am a member of the American, California, and Monterey Bay Dental Societies, as well as the Scotts Valley Chamber of Commerce.  I have served on the board of the Monterey Dental Society.  Additionally, I am a member of the Academy of General Dentistry, of the Academy of Osseointegration, and I am a certified CEREC CAD-CAM Provider . I have advanced training in the placement of Lumineers, Invisilign, and the MDI mini implant system. My hobbies include Skiing, jogging, beer making and astronomy.
